Great chapter on Bougainville, detailed maps and info about the RNZAF Corsairs and the RAAF Wirraway/Boomerang.
 
The AWM is a fantastic place to visit as well. The Zero in the Aircraft Hall is reputed to have been one of Sakai's, they have Richtofen's Spandau and flying boots. I take a look every time I'm in Canberra. and a visit to the off site storage and restoration centre is a must.
